There is a problem that occurs in different games when played turn-based: a button that commands an action which does not require confirmation appears exactly at the same location as the "next table" button. Then, if the other player finishes his turn exactly at the time you are pressing the "next table" button, the button is replaced by the action button and you select the action against your will.

Examples:
- Kahuna: the "do not draw" button appears in place of "next table" - you are not asked to confirm, meaning that you are losing one turn
- Spyrium: the "start activation phase" button appears in place of "next table" - no confirmation required either, meaning that, if still have free meeples, you will not be able to play them during this round

Possible solutions: add confirmation for these actions OR place the buttons at different locations.

You may think that it is unlikely that the other player finishes his turn exactly when you decide to press the "next table" button, but believe me, it happened to me at least 20 times...
